"Majesty," the second track from Nicki Minaj’s 2018 album Queen , serves as a high-octane declaration of dominance in the rap industry. Featuring British singer Labrinth and hip-hop legend Eminem, the song is a sonic display of lyrical technicality and thematic royalty.
At its core, "Majesty" is an anthem about reclaiming and defending one's throne. Nicki Minaj Majesty ft Eminem&Labrinth

The track was produced by Labrinth and Eminem, blending melodic elements with aggressive hip-hop beats. : Eminem uses his verse to critique the state of modern rap, advocating for higher lyrical effort. Notably, he broke his own speed record from "Rap God" on this track, delivering 123 syllables in approximately 12 seconds—roughly 10.3 syllables per second.
: The song closes with a menacing outro from Minaj directed at her detractors: "Jealousy is a disease, die slow".
